Post Job Free
Sign in

software developer

Location:
United States
Salary:
50k
Posted:
April 17, 2010

Contact this candidate

Resume:

CHANDANA K

Phno: 703-***-****

*********.********@*****.***

SUMMARY

• Java/J2EE Programmer with over 2 years of IT experience with primary expertise in Object Oriented, J2EE and Client Server technologies.

• Experience in developing Multi-Tier Web applications using Java, J2EE, JSP, Servlets, MVC Struts, Spring, Hibernate, JDBC, XML, HTML, JavaScript, CSS.

• Experience in Configuring and deploying applications on Apache Tomcat, BEA Web Logic 8.x/7.x/9.x servers.

• Experience in database development using Oracle,SQL, PL/SQ.

• Experience in Software Analysis and Design using Unified Modeling Language (UML) and Rational Rose.

• Experience in database development using Oracle.

• Developed XML documents with DTDs /XML Schema/XPath, using DOM, SAX parsers and converting XML documents to HTML using XSL.

• Good team player having excellent analytical, problem solving, communication and interpersonal skills, with ability to interact with individuals involved in the project.

EDUCATION

Master of Science in Computer Science (Graduated - Dec’08)

George Mason University, Fairfax, VA

Bachelor of Technology in Computer Science (Graduated - May’07)

Jawaharlal Nehru Technological University, India

CERTIFICATION

• Sun Certified Java Programmer (SCJP)

• Sun Certified Web Component Developer (SCWCD)

TECHNICAL SKILLS

Languages C,Java, J2EE

J2EE Technologies Servlets, JDBC, JSP, XML(SAX, DOM), XPath, XSLT, XSD, DTD, Web Services (SOAP, WSDL)

Web Technologies CSS, Javascript, HTML, Jquery.

Software Revision Control System CVS

Frameworks Struts1.2, Spring 2.x, Hibernate 3.0

Databases Oracle9i

Operating Systems Windows 98/2000, XP, Vista, UNIX.

IDE/ GUI Tools Flex 3.0 Builder, Eclipse 3.x, Net Beans 6.5.1.

Application/ Web Server Apache Tomcat 5.5, Web Logic 8.x/9.x.

PROFESSIONAL EXPERIENCE

Vistakon(Eye Care Division Of Johnson And Johnson), USA (Nov’09 – Till date)

J&J Visioncare CA(JJVCCA)

Role: Software Developer

This is an ecp(eye care professional) registration application, where the users register their practice. They are eligible to enroll in different programs based on some criteria like designation, account number, email . They are allowed to view, add, remove programs .They can check and update their account , and mypractice profile. They can check the statistics for their practice.

Responsibilities

• Used Struts tag libraries (like html, bean, and logic) in the JSP pages.

• Development of Action Form classes for validations and Action Classes forming the business layer of MVC based Struts architecture

• Involved in creating User interface Templates using JSP, Tiles and HTML.

• Used Jquery for dynamic display of form fields.

• Designed and developed DAO components which use Criteria Interface for generating dynamic queries for various database tables.

• Used form beans for storing data.

• Used SQL Developer as an IDE to access the oracle data base

• Mapped various backend tables using Hibernate.

• Internationalization of messages and labels to support various languages using Struts

• Localization of tiles.

• Performed client side validation using JavaScript.

• Configured hibernate configuration file, developed POJO’s.

• Performed Unit Testing.

• Used CVS for version controlling.

Environment: Html, Javascript, Jquery, struts1.2, Hibernate, CVS, weblogic 8.1, J2EE 1.4, J2SE 1.4, Oracle 9i

Teleparadigm Networks Ltd, India

SMS based pull campaign processing systems(SPPS) (Nov’06 - April’07)

Role: Software Developer

SMS Pull Processing Systems (SPPS) is a new model of directory service implemented using mobile infrastructure. It enables enterprisers to reach their customers looking for specific information. The system comprises of three modules: SMS ME server admin support system, Campaign publisher portal, SMS ME service delivery system. These modules provide hosting services, management services and service information to the mobile users. For mobile users, the system offers promotions, discounts and coupons.

Responsibilities

• Developed Struts components such as Form beans, Action classes for the new screens.

• Used the Struts Validator framework & JavaScript for user input validation.

• Implemented the MVC design pattern using the Struts Framework.

• Involved in the development of the user interface using the Struts, JSP, Custom Tags and JavaScript.

• Internationalization of messages and labels to support various languages using Struts.

• Provided the Object-Relational Mapping between business objects and database using the Hibernate.

• Used Log4j API for logging.

Environment: Html, JavaScript, Struts 1.2, Hibernate, J2EE 1.4, J2SE 1.4, Oracle 9i, Tomcat 5.5.

Infotech, India (May ‘ 06 – Nov’ 06)

Online Air Ticket Refund Tracking

Role: Software Developer

This is a travel domain application (on MVC pattern) for Carlson Wagonlit Travel. The objective of this application is to provide facility of refund of air tickets. When a user wants to refund a ticket, user register himself and submit his request for ticket refund, system generates a receipt for user, which contains all the details of ticket and receipt number. User can monitor his refund of tickets using receipt number.

Responsibilities:

• Identified the Business Requirements of the project.

• Involved in preparing the Detailed Design document for the project.

• Developed UI using JSP, Tiles, Java Script, CSS.

• Developed the application using Struts framework.

• Created tile definitions, struts-config files, and validation files for the application using Struts framework.

• Implemented Action Classes and Action Forms using Struts framework.

• Created POJO and DAO using ORM tool Hibernate

• Design Database tables.

Environment: JSP, Struts1.2, J2EE, Apache Tomcat 5, Html, Javascript, Oracle 9i , Hibernate

ACADEMIC PROJECTS

Online Photo Album (Aug’08 - Dec’08)

Online Photo Album is a J2EE web application. It allows view and management of personal photographs. Users are provided the capability to upload photos. Photos can be grouped in individual albums. User authentication is implemented using programmatic security by checking credentials in Oracle database.

• Developed the front end for the application using Struts, JSP and HTML.

• Implemented client side validations using JavaScript.

• Using the Struts plug-in, developed the Action classes and Action Form classes.

• Created JSP using Struts Tag Libraries and configured everything in the deployment descriptor files.

• Setup the Struts Framework and the Validation Framework and error pages for the application.

• Hibernate 3.0 was used to store persistence data into the oracle database.

Environment: JSP, Struts1.2, J2EE, Apache Tomcat 5, Html, Javascript, oracle 9i, Hibernate.

RightDB – Online Job Portal ( May ’08-Aug’08)

The RightDB job portal is established to provide an online career network for the job seeker, connecting progressive companies with prospective employees who can provide experience and dedication. This Job Portal allows Job seeker to apply for a job online by viewing jobs Posted by companies. It allows Online job posting for companies.

• Participated in requirement analysis and design.

• Developed UI using JSP, Tiles, Java Script,CSS.

• Developed the application using Struts framework.

• Created tile definitions, struts-config files, and validation files for the application using Struts framework.

• Implemented Action Classes and Action Forms using Struts framework.

• Developed Data Access Objects (DAO) using JDBC API for Database access.

• Design Database tables and participated in development of SQL queries.

Environment: JSP, Struts1.2, J2EE, Apache Tomcat 5, Html, Javascript, Oracle9i.

Degree Audit System (Jan’08 - April’08)

Designed an Audit system which evaluates the degree requirements of GMU students majored in software engineering to understand the effectiveness of good user friendly interface.

• Performed Object Oriented Analysis and Design and Modeling using UML .

• Used Jquery for dynamic display, HTML, CSS for the front end.

• Developed JSPs using Apache Struts for front-end development to enhance view capabilities and incorporate MVC design pattern.

• Developed action classes, action forms and form beans for storing data.

• Connected to Oracle using JDBC

• Used Java Script for validating user data.

Environment: J2EE, JDBC, Apache Struts1.2, Apache Tomcat 5 , Oracle9i, JSP, Html, Java Script, CSS, Jquery, UML.

Airline Reservation System (Sep’07- Dec’07)

Developed an Airline Reservation System which is intended to provide information needed to reserve seats on certain flights.

• Designed a database schema for a sample Airline Reservation System.

• Used servlets for the business logic.

• Used JSP, HTML, CSS for the presentation layer.

• Used JDBC for database access.

• Used javascript for client side validation.

• Wrote SQL queries to retrieve, modify and update data from and to the Oracle 9i database.

Environment: J2EE, JDBC, SQL, Servlets, JSP, HTML, Javascript, CSS, Apache Tomcat 5.5, oracle9i.



Contact this candidate